Praying Book Club

What makes it possible for seeds to grow? If soil conditions are right with moisture & sunlight, seeds will sprout. What are the right conditions for spiritual growth? Prayer, persistence, and patience. Ponder the following: How would you describe your relationship with God? Do you pray? Why, how, where and how often do you pray? Prayer is a life changing conversation with God. "Prayer is both a gift of grace and a determined response on our part" (CCC 2726). Dedicate 10 minutes a day consistently to prayer and see what happens.

Global Outreach a Catholic Program have you ever wanted to make a difference in a young person's life? If so, Global Outreach, a Catholic student exchange program is the chance in a lifetime. Our students from five countries, the Czech Republic, Hungary, Lithuania, Poland, and Slovakia, study in U.S. Catholic high schools during their junior year and return to their countries to make a difference in their schools, in the Church, and in their society. We hope that next year we will be able to send students to Pacelli High School again, but this can only happen if host families can be found for the students. Please open the door of your home and heart to a wonderful young person who will not only bring something special to the school, but also to your home. Students arrive in early August 2018 and return around June 15, 2019. Outreach Funds Available to Local Non-Profits St.Bronislava Outreach funds available to local non-profits. Local non-profit organizations (must be 501C) which serve persons who live in Portage County are invited to apply for grant dollars through the St. Bronislava Church Social Concerns Outreach Fund. The fund was established in 1995 to address human needs locally and nationally. As these needs continue to put demands on local service organizations, St. Bronislava continues to extend a helping hand to those non-profit organizations working to promote and protect the dignity of the human person. To obtain the grant form, download it at www.stbrons.com. Mail the completed form to: Attn: Social Concerns Committee, St. Bronislava Parish, PO Box 158, Plover, WI 54467-0158. All grant applications must be postmarked by May 14, 2018.
